About the Role

We are seeking a highly motivated and experienced Digital Performance Manager to lead our digital performance discipline, ensuring that analytics and insight are embedded into our DNA.

This is a new role that will work closely with the rest of our Digital Platforms and SEO leadership team to define and measure success across the department.

The successful candidate will have a strong background in managing web analytics and performance teams, with experience in leading a team of performance analysts and those that work in website analytics.

Key Responsibilities
  • Analysing a variety of data sources and types to generate measurement and insight and identify areas for improvement.
  • Supporting the Digital Platforms and SEO department with insight to make priority decisions.
  • Analysing experiments (A/B & MVT) to improve SEO, user engagement, and conversion rates.
  • Exploring and implementing personalisation use cases to enhance the customer experience and drive outcomes.
  • Developing and communicating metrics, insights and recommendations to stakeholders in a clear and concise manner.
  • Leading your team of performance leads to help create their regular reporting requirements to support delivery squads.
About You

We are looking for a highly motivated and experienced individual with a strong background in managing web analytics and performance teams.

The successful candidate will have:

  • Experience in leading a team of performance analysts and those that work in website analytics.
  • A breadth and depth of experience and expertise in Adobe Analytics and Adobe Target to develop dashboards and generate insight.
  • Strong analytical and critical thinking skills with the ability to turn data from a variety of sources into actionable insight.
  • Proven experience of analysing robust experiments with measurable value through A/B and MVT testing.
  • Ability to work collaboratively with multi-discipline teams and positively influence business stakeholders.
  • Ability to present complex data in an engaging, clear and concise manner – Using data and insight to create a compelling story for stakeholders across the business
  • Proven commercial awareness, translating insight and results into a clear articulation of value.
